RE: 21cc Weedeater Featherlite
The only way they are viable is to do a extensive reporting - deck job - piston crowning - crankcase stuffing - as well as the bigger carb.
A stock one, though they are just fine as a small weed whacker, just doesn't have much gusto as a model engine. It's a 14-6 at 7000 engine. Your time would be better spent on a Homelite or Ryobi. Enjoy, Jim |
